Fixed-term contract for 1 year, 1.0 FTE.
We are seeking to appoint an Assistant Professor with experience of developing or delivering modules or skills in the field of Health Systems. The successful candidate will have a developing professional or academic experience of Health Systems and play a role in developing modules in areas health systems modelling and control for quality improvement. We are particularly interested in applicants with knowledge of health systems modelling, systems engineering and application of Machine Leaning/Artificial Intelligence (ML/AI) for quality improvement.
This role is on the University of Warwick Teaching Career Pathway, providing opportunities for advancement up to and including Professor level. There is significant growth in demand for our education programmes and this is an exciting opportunity for you to develop your professional profile and work as part of a world- renowned education group.
This is an education focussed appointment and we are looking for candidates who can demonstrate experience of teaching in higher education and a passion for impactful education and positive student outcomes. Candidates with a track record in research outputs but limited educational experience are unlikely to be shortlisted for this role.
